William Oates Obituary

OATES, WILLIAM ERNEST, 82
Williston - William Ernest "BUDDY" Oates, retired truck driver for Whitehurst & Sons, 82, Williston. Mr. Oates was a faithful member of Greater New Bethel Missionary Baptist Church, Flemington. Funeral Services will be on Saturday, JUNE 18, 2011, 11 AM, Unity Temple of Deliverance International Center. Reverend Michael Maeweathers, Sr.-WORDS OF COMFORT- a wake service will be held on Thursday 6PM at Sellers Funeral Home. The family will be receiving friends during this hour of reflection. Visitation will be at Sellers Funeral home on Friday from 9 TO 7PM. Family and friends are asked to meet at the residence of Mrs. Ola M. Hicks (114 S.E. 1Oth St. Williston, FL) on Sat. at 10:15 AM to form the funeral cortege. No viewing following eulogy. Survivors to cherish the memories of Mr. Oates who was preceded in death by his wife Viola Hicks Oates, two sons; Ernest Oates and Lamonica Oates (Quillamae) both of Williston, FL, four daughters; Gwendolyn O. Martin (Minister Carlton Martin) of Reddick, FL; Evelena Richards (Roderick) of Gainesville, FL; Beverly Oates (Eley) of Williston, FL; Theo Yvonne Oates (Ray) of Gainesville, FL; three sisters; Evelyn James of Hawthome, FL; Eamestine Boone of Ocala, FL; Geraldine Oates of Flemington, FL; 9 grandchildren, 10 great grandchildren.
